Spray from side to side for an even finish. Wait 10 minutes for the first coat to dry. Apply a second coat and then a third, leaving 10 minutes between both. Once you have applied three coats, wait 24 hours for the seal to completely dry before you start decorating.

WebJun 20, 2013 · Drill 10mm diameter holes into the plaster using a masonry bit to allow moisture to escape. Then place a fan close by if possible and allow this to run for a few hours. Fill the holes with exterior Polycell Crack Filler (not interior crack filler) and proceed with the Plascon Dampseal application. WebThe below methods are ways of curing damp on internal walls: Condensation: Improving the ventilation e.g. add kitchen and bathroom fans where necessary. Allow the fan to run for a long period of time to allow any moisture to be cleared from the room. Use a Condensation Mould Kit to remove any mould from walls and surfaces.
